#R8071 12.TELECOMMUNICATION SERVICES RENEWAL FROM GRANITE, VERIZON AND T-MOBILEResolutionTemp. Reso. #R8071 approving the renewal of City phone telecommunication services from Granite Telecommunications, L.L.C., in an amount of $144,000, for Fiscal Year 2024, through the utilization of NCPA contract number 01-99, and cellular telecommunication services from Verizon and T-Mobile, in an amount of $327,600, for Fiscal Year 2024, utilizing the State of Florida Department of Management Services Agreement Number DMS 19/20-006C. (IT Network Manager Jerry Logan)   Not available Not available
#R8072 23.Florida Recreation Development Assistance ProgramResolutionTemp. Reso. #R8072 authorizing acceptance of the Florida Recreation Development Assistance Program Grant from the State of Florida Department of Environmental Protection in the amount of $200,000, with the City commitment to matching funds equating to $200,000, for Vizcaya Park Enhancements. (Parks & Recreation Assistant Director Holly Hicks and Financial Services Grants Accounting Manager Yenevin Capote)   Not available Not available

#R8088 17.Property and Casualty Insurance RenewalResolutionTemp. Reso. #R8088 authorizing the renewal of various insurance coverages for the City’s Property and Casualty Insurance Program as part of the City’s Comprehensive Risk Management Program, effective April 1, 2024; approving a projected premium cost of $4,993,096, not-to-exceed $5,000,000, including taxes and fees; declaring by four-fifths affirmative vote that applying the City’s Competitive Procurement Procedures to the insurance renewals is not in the City’s best interest, thereby exempting the insurance renewals from the City’s competitive procurement requirements; authorizing the Human Resources Director to negotiate lower premium amounts due under the insurance renewals; authorizing the City Manager to execute the insurance renewal agreements. (Human Resources Director Randy Cross)   Not available Not available

#R8094 19.Procure Environmental and Legal Svcs from Goldstein Environmental Law Firm to Oppose MDCC Proposed Waste To Energy FacilityResolutionTemp. Reso. #R8094 authorizing the City Manager to engage the professional services of The Goldstein Environmental Law Firm and the total expenditure of three hundred thousand dollars to oppose Miami-Dade County’s siting, permitting, construction, and operation of a Solid Waste to Energy Campus at the Opa-Locka West Airport site that is located adjacent to the City of Miramar’s border, through the utilization of Procurement Authority Exemption 2-413(2), professional services. (Sponsored by Mayor Wayne M. Messam, Vice Mayor Alexandra P. Davis, and the City Commission) (Deputy City Manager Kelvin L. Baker)   Not available Not available
